
Excel表格打开都是乱码的原因有很多,主要包括:文件编码问题、区域和语言设置错误、文件损坏、软件版本不兼容。 其中,文件编码问题是最常见的原因。当Excel文件使用的编码与当前系统或软件的默认编码不匹配时,就可能导致乱码现象。为了更好地理解和解决这个问题,我们可以从以下几个方面进行详细探讨。
一、文件编码问题
文件编码问题通常发生在不同软件或操作系统之间传输文件时。例如,当一个Excel文件在Windows系统中创建,然后在Mac系统中打开,或者从不同的Excel版本之间传输时,编码不匹配会导致乱码。
1、识别文件编码
要解决编码问题,首先需要识别文件的编码类型。常见的编码类型包括UTF-8、ANSI、Unicode等。可以使用文本编辑器(如Notepad++)来打开文件,并查看文件的编码类型。
2、调整编码设置
在Excel中打开文件时,可以通过“数据”选项卡下的“自文本”功能来导入文件,并在导入过程中选择正确的编码类型。这样可以确保文件内容按照正确的编码方式进行解析,从而避免乱码问题。
3、保存为兼容格式
在保存Excel文件时,可以选择保存为兼容性更好的文件格式,例如CSV格式,并在保存时选择合适的编码类型(如UTF-8)。这可以在不同系统和软件之间传输文件时减少乱码的可能性。
二、区域和语言设置错误
Excel的区域和语言设置也会影响文件的显示效果。如果Excel的默认语言与文件的语言不匹配,可能会导致乱码。
1、检查和修改区域设置
在Excel中,可以通过“文件”菜单中的“选项”来访问“语言”设置。在这里,可以选择合适的显示语言和编辑语言,以确保文件内容能够正确显示。
2、系统区域设置
操作系统的区域和语言设置也会影响Excel的显示效果。在Windows系统中,可以通过“控制面板”中的“区域和语言”选项来调整系统的区域和语言设置。确保系统的区域设置与文件的语言相匹配。
三、文件损坏
有时候,Excel文件本身可能已经损坏,导致无法正常打开和显示。
1、尝试修复文件
Excel提供了一些内置的工具来修复损坏的文件。在打开文件时,可以选择“打开并修复”选项来尝试修复文件。这个选项可以在文件打开对话框中通过下拉菜单找到。
2、使用第三方修复工具
如果内置工具无法修复文件,可以考虑使用第三方的Excel修复工具。这些工具通常能够更深入地分析和修复文件损坏的问题。
四、软件版本不兼容
不同版本的Excel软件之间可能存在兼容性问题,导致文件无法正常打开和显示。
1、更新软件
确保使用的Excel软件是最新版本。微软定期发布更新,修复已知的兼容性问题和其他Bug。可以通过Office更新功能来检查并安装最新的更新。
2、使用兼容模式
如果需要在不同版本的Excel之间传输文件,可以考虑使用兼容模式来保存文件。在保存文件时,可以选择“Excel 97-2003 工作簿”格式,这种格式在较旧版本的Excel中也能够正常打开和显示。
五、总结
综上所述,Excel表格打开都是乱码的原因多种多样,但通过识别和调整文件编码、检查和修改区域和语言设置、尝试修复文件、更新软件和使用兼容模式,可以有效解决大多数乱码问题。在实际操作中,建议逐步排查各个可能的原因,并采取相应的措施进行修复和调整。这样不仅可以解决当前的问题,还能够在未来避免类似情况的发生。
相关问答FAQs:
1. 为什么我打开Excel表格时会出现乱码?
打开Excel表格时出现乱码的原因可能有多种,例如文件编码不匹配、使用了不支持的字体、或者是数据本身存在特殊字符等。下面是解决这个问题的几种方法。
2. 如何解决Excel表格打开时出现乱码的问题?
首先,您可以尝试修改文件的编码方式,将其与您的操作系统或Excel程序的默认编码方式匹配。其次,您可以检查表格中是否使用了特殊字符或不支持的字体,如果有,请将其替换为常用字符或支持的字体。另外,您还可以尝试将文件转换为其他格式(如CSV)后再打开,或者在打开时选择正确的编码方式。
3. 为什么我的Excel表格在不同电脑上打开时会出现乱码?
Excel表格在不同电脑上打开时出现乱码的原因可能是因为不同电脑的默认编码方式不一样。您可以尝试在打开Excel表格时手动选择正确的编码方式,或者将文件转换为其他格式后再打开。另外,确保您的电脑上已安装了所使用的字体,以免出现字体不匹配的问题。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4582270